Poetry cannot ward off storms, but it can hold your hand and be your guiding light as you sail through one storm at a time.

From a survivor of childhood trauma and life-shattering heartbreaks comes an anthology of poetry and prose that is all about helping you find the light in the dark.
As I Tread On narrates the journey of a man through emotional emptiness and isolation, ironically, in a world boasting of connectivity at the fingertips. His story is the story of many of us, fighting a grotesque battle against depression, heartbreaks, and endless disappointments. Still, he grinds against the pain and we follow him on his quest to find inner peace by clinging on to the world of words, imageries, and metaphors, and ultimately, to his healing through poetry.

A blend of free verse, sonnets, and narrative poetry with interwoven personal essays to suit your every mood and make you feel whole again.

***

As I tread on
Down the forest path,
Autumn leaves crumble,
Leaving behind footprints
On the dew-soaked mud,
I see‒
A new dawn,
A new me ‒
At the Horizon,
And I tread on…
